FLIP FOR PHONICS™ ACTIVITIES ACTIVITY 8 - MISSING LETTER Missing Letter This activity strengthens spelling skills. Your child must decide which letter is missing in order to complete a word. He or she must rely on the knowledge of letter sounds in order to complete this activity. Using the objects and words on the cards, your child will be asked to choose which letter is missing from them in order to complete the word.
FLIP FOR PHONICS™ ACTIVITY 9 - SPELLING ACTIVITIES Spelling This activity explores spelling skills. Your child must rely on his or her knowledge of letters and sounds in order to sound out and spell simple words. Your child will be asked to spell words on the cards. As your child presses each letter button, the name of the letter will be identified. After the final letter has been pressed, the friendly voice will spell the entire word again and say the name of the object.

FLIP FOR PHONICS™ BATTERIES BATTERY INSTALLATION 1. Make sure the unit is off. 2. Locate the battery cover on the back of the unit. Use a coin or screwdriver to loosen the screw. Install 2 new ‘AA’ (UM-3/LR6) batteries following the diagram inside the battery box. (The use of new, alkaline batteries is recommended for maximum performance.) 3. Replace the battery cover and tighten the screw to secure the battery cover.
FLIP FOR PHONICS™ MAINTENANCE CARE AND MAINTENANCE 1. Keep the unit clean by wiping it with a slightly damp cloth. 2. Keep the unit out of direct sunlight and away from any direct heat source. 3. Remove the batteries when the unit is not in use for an extended period of time. 4. Do not drop the unit on hard surfaces and do not expose the unit to moisture or water.
